Murray: Rangers to focus on developing own talent

Rangers chairman Sir David Murray has hinted at a scaling down of big-spending on transfers. He said: "Existing levels of expenditure cannot be maintained in the current economic climate and, as we look to the future, it is becoming more important to focus on the development of young players to ensure long-term sustainability.

"I genuinely believe we are now seeing a steady stream of young talent emerging from Murray Park and will continue to do so.

"We are extremely disappointed not to qualify for Europe this season. But we have regrouped and invested, as we promised, in the playing squad and I know that we can count on our fans' support as we strive to bring back the league title to Ibrox."
